What's the Problem?
The
verible.filelistis essential for LSP to function with multiple files, i.e. finding the definition of a module from another source.However, it's not documented in the VSCode Extension README and neither does a command exist for generating the filelist, which may cause confusion for users who is not quite familiar with the
Veribletoolkit.What has been done in this PR?
.v,.sv,.vhand.svhare set as default) and generating theverible.filelistat the project root, then restarting the language server so that the new filelist can be loaded.Quick Startsection is added to theREADME.md, helping new users understand how to use the verible language server with VSCode properly.
